Materials are represented by elements, or zones, which form a grid that is adjusted by the user to fit the shape of the object to be modelled. The two programmes simulate the behaviour of soils, structures built on soil, rock or other materials that may undergone plastic flow when their yield limits are reached. FLAC Version 3.3 is a two-dimensional explicit finite difference program for solving mining and geotechnical engineering problems.
